Wim Hof's path to success has not been without its challenges. In 1995, tragedy struck when his wife committed suicide, leaving him to care for their four small children. This profound loss deeply impacted Hof, shaping his perspective on life and his ability to overcome adversity.
Through his own experiences, Wim Hof discovered the power of stepping out of one's comfort zone and embracing discomfort as a means of unlocking true potential. He broke numerous records related to blistering cold exposure, including climbing Everest and Kilimanjaro in shorts, running a half marathon barefoot above the Arctic Circle, and spending over 112 minutes covered in ice cubes.
Wim Hof's pioneering "Wim Hof Method," combining cold exposure, breathing techniques, and meditation, has garnered significant attention. He claims that following this method enables individuals to focus, reduce stress and pain, and improve sleep.
